This is somewhat odd, but Nintendo is coming out with the Wi-Fi Network Adapter [JP] for the Wii. It’s odd because the Wii works with Wi-Fi right out of the box, unless you consider going into settings and configuring your Wii to use your local network not right out of the box. This adapter attempts to solve that problem.

It can work as a stand-alone router or as a network bridge, sitting between your router and Wii. We lack the specific stats, though, like if it works with 802.11n or anything.

It’s scheduled to come out in Japan on September 18 for around $53.
